Notes
Comes with Yellow CD Tray
Tracks 1, 3 to 7, 9, 10, 13 recorded at Brilliant Studios, San Francisco, CA. Mixed at Prairie Sun, Cotati, CA.
Tracks 2, 8, 12 recorded and mixed at Razor's Edge, San Francisco, CA.
Track 11 recorded and mixed at Laundry Room, Seattle, WA.
Catalog# 7 82532-2 appears on spine of case. Catalog# 82532-2 appears in liner notes and on CD itself.
Note on Matrix/Runout variant 4: M1S2 is only partially visible, and may even be M1S3.

Imagine yourself in a cruddy record store in a dirty city in 1993. It could be Tacoma, it could be Cleveland, it could be Tempe. There's posters promoting "Nevermind" and Alice in Chains and "Beavis and Butthead" is just starting to perfectly capture the mind-numbing apathy of the western teen's condition.
Now, what's playing in the background? "Houdini", of course. This album is the audible cherry to top off this memory cake. The band was heavy as hell and didn't care about anything. The unexpected percussive asides, disturbing subject matter, and incredibly low-tuned bass garnered a niche following that has grown into a fevered cult today. Turn off your brain and let this one smack you around for an hour.
